1. Lovoir Day Spa Christchurch

Lovoir Day Spa is a long-time favourite in Christchurch. We liked that their facials always start with a consultation, which is in-depth enough to cover skin goals and manage expectations.
As for the services, their indulgent facial is one of the best offerings. This one is comprehensive, including deep cleansing, gentle exfoliation, massage, and hydration. At $149, we find it fairly priced too, compared to what clients get.
Ambience played a major part in the overall client experience too. Their clinic is clean, modern, and quietly elegant – from the reception to the treatment rooms. It’s no surprise that most clients book this place for group treatments.
Appointment, however, can be a challenge if you’re doing weekend or group bookings. It can often require 2 to 3 weeks in advance. Once you push through, though, we find the rest of the experience to be seamless and attentive.
Many first-time clients appreciate that their professionals often suggest additional or supplementary treatments to what was originally booked. However, we do want to note that this will feel like upselling pressure to other customers.

2. Nicola Quinn Beauty & Day Spa

Tucked into the Merivale neighborhood, this high-end spa offers an inviting atmosphere as soon as you walk in. It has a nice ambience, which is owed to their plush decor, calming music, and high level of cleanliness in every space.
According to the patrons we spoke with, the facials are always tailored to their concerns, which usually revolved around dryness and dryness. They also revealed that the results always come as soon as one treatment alone.
Their facial menu includes the O Cosmedics facial, which is among their most popular options. This is often chosen for deep hydration and rejuvenation that’s ideal for first-timers,
For more in-depth services, though, we prefer their indulgence package. It’s naturally expensive, but we still find it fair. Clients can already enjoy 2.5 hours of treatment, including facial, massage, and even a post-treatment platter.
The only thing we didn’t like was their price adjustment policy, which affects clients trying to get discounts from promotions. We recommend using promotions like gift vouchers as soon as you possibly can to avoid them being void.

3. Beauty at the Vale

What we liked about Beauty at the Vale is that their facial offerings are flexible and designed around the client’s needs. Rather than pushing pre-set routines, their team tailors each facial after a 15-minute consultation.
We like the level of options available to clients, with the ability to choose from 45-, 60-, or 75-minute sessions. At prices that range from $149 to $209, we find that the value matches the quality of service and inclusions.
Each session includes a double cleanse, enzyme exfoliation, decolletage, and facial massage. What’s even better is that clients can choose based on their level of comfort, availability, and budget.
Apart from this, they also have advanced offerings such as Osmosis Revitapen facials and Dermalux LED treatment. According to loyal patrons, the results are visible after one treatment, with zero downtime after treatments too.
Just be advised that certain services like these advanced offerings can feel overpriced when compared to other clinics.

4. Embrace Skin & Beauty

We’re happy to note that Embrace offers a solid variety of skin treatments. From collagen-infused facials to high-end combination services, they’re a great one-stop shop for those who want to stick to a single clinic for everything.
What earned our favour best is the level of personalisation they offer in each procedure. Through consultations, we can tell that their staff have solid skincare knowledge, offering treatment suggestions without pushy upselling.
Another noteworthy factor is the attention to detail when it comes to client experience. The spa beds were super comfortable with soft linens and calming aromas that filled the room. Even the staff’s tone when speaking makes things feel elevated.
The prices for services vary, though we see how they somehow lean towards the pricier side for certain treatments. The value for money is there, though, and their most popular treatments really won’t break the bank.
To enjoy their services, we recommend booking at least 2 weeks in advance, especially if you’re eyeing a weekend spot. They’re not the most convenient when it comes to short notices, so early planning is a smart move.

5. Acacia Beauty

Similar to most clinics, it’s the range of personalised offerings that drew us into Acacia Beauty too. For starters, they have the bespoke facial (their most popular). This already includes a deep cleanse, exfoliation, steam, mask, and massage.
The best part is that the price isn’t crazy expensive at $139 for 60 minutes. On top of that, we can say the results are worth it too – clients seemed to leave with visibly brighter skin. They told us that they felt deeply relaxed as well.
The clinic is also a fantastic spot for busy professionals who need a quick yet effective refresh. They achieve this through their quick pick-me-up facial for 40 minutes at $89. Even though the session is short, the results are just as impressive.
Another aspect we loved was how services often include small add-ons, including back rubs, hand massages, or eyebrow tinting. Bookings are also made easy with reminders, and gift vouchers are available for those looking for a nice gift.
We just happen to meet clients who aren’t 100% satisfied with their services, saying the results weren’t up to par. However, we don’t consider this as inconsistencies with results, considering the complaint doesn’t represent the majority of the testimonies.
